You may have some slight bleeding before your skin scabs over. Try a packet of frozen peas wrapped in a tea towel. Holding an ice pack to your skin may help. Your skin may be red with a raised rash for a short while after treatment. The tattoo should become lighter with each treatment.Ī gel is used to cool and soothe your skin, and it might be covered with a dressing. The session will take about 10 to 30 minutes, depending on the size of your tattoo. Some people say this feels like an elastic band snapping against your skin. A local anaesthetic cream may be used to numb the skin.Ī handheld device will be pressed on your skin to trigger a laser. On the day, you'll be given special goggles to protect your eyes. You'll need to shave the area of skin before the appointment. Read more about choosing who will do your cosmetic procedure. The cost of removing a tattoo will depend on its size and the number of sessions needed. What to think about before you have a tattoo removed Cost This process is rarely available on the NHS. The energy from the laser breaks down the tattoo ink into tiny fragments, which are eventually absorbed into the bloodstream and safely passed out of the body. Unwanted tattoos can be removed gradually over a series of sessions using a laser.
